Fibromyalgia is a chronic (long-lasting) disorder characterized by widespread musculoskeletal pain, often accompanied by fatigue, sleep disturbances, and cognitive dysfunction. Historically misunderstood, modern medicine now recognizes fibromyalgia as a disorder of pain processing. The primary pathophysiology involves central sensitization, a state where the central nervous system (CNS) becomes high-strung or hyper-reactive to stimuli. In patients with fibromyalgia, the brain and spinal cord process signals from both painful and non-painful stimuli differently, effectively 'turning up the volume' on pain sensations. This neurobiological shift means that sensations that would not be painful for most people are perceived as significant pain by those with the condition.
Fibromyalgia is a prevalent global health concern. According to the Centers for Disease Control and Prevention (CDC, 2024), fibromyalgia affects approximately 4 million adults in the United States, representing about 2% of the adult population. While it can affect individuals of all ages, including children, most people are diagnosed during middle age, and the prevalence increases as people get older. Research published in the Journal of Rheumatology (2023) indicates that women are twice as likely as men to be diagnosed, though this gap may be narrowing as diagnostic awareness for male presentations improves.

The impact of fibromyalgia on quality of life can be profound. Patients often struggle with 'invisible' symptoms that make maintaining consistent employment difficult. The National Institutes of Health (NIH, 2023) notes that the condition frequently leads to higher rates of disability and lower household income. Relationships can be strained as family members may struggle to understand the fluctuating nature of the symptoms, where a patient may feel functional one day and completely bedridden the next due to a 'flare' (a sudden increase in symptom severity).

Early indicators of fibromyalgia are often subtle and can be mistaken for general overexertion or aging. Patients frequently report a persistent 'flu-like' feeling, characterized by a dull ache in the muscles and a sense of heaviness in the limbs. Another early sign is unrefreshing sleep; individuals may wake up feeling exhausted despite spending eight or more hours in bed. Sensitivity to touch, such as feeling pain from the pressure of clothing or a light hug, is a hallmark early warning sign of central sensitization.

Currently, there is no known cure for fibromyalgia, but it is a highly manageable condition. Treatment focuses on minimizing symptoms and improving overall health through a combination of medication, lifestyle changes, and behavioral therapy. Many patients find that with a dedicated management plan, they can lead productive and active lives with significantly reduced pain levels. Research continues into the underlying neurobiology of the disease, which may lead to more targeted therapies in the future.
There is a strong evidence base suggesting that fibromyalgia has a genetic component. Research indicates that you are several times more likely to develop the condition if a first-degree relative, such as a parent or sibling, also has it. Specific genes related to the transport and metabolism of serotonin and dopamine are currently being studied as potential markers. However, genetics are only one piece of the puzzle, as environmental triggers are usually required to 'activate' the condition.

Some patients may experience secondary symptoms including tension headaches, irritable bowel syndrome (IBS), interstitial cystitis (painful bladder syndrome), and temporomandibular joint (TMJ) disorders. Numbness or tingling in the hands and feet (paresthesia) and sensitivity to light, noise, or temperature changes are also frequently reported.

The exact etiology of fibromyalgia remains unknown, but it is widely accepted as a multi-factorial disorder. Research published in The Lancet (2023) suggests that it is a disorder of pain regulation in the brain. Factors such as neurotransmitter imbalances (specifically serotonin, norepinephrine, and dopamine) and an increase in Substance P (a chemical that transmits pain signals) play a role. There is also evidence of mitochondrial dysfunction at the cellular level, which may contribute to the profound muscle fatigue experienced by patients.
According to the National Institute of Arthritis and Musculoskeletal and Skin Diseases (NIAMS, 2023), individuals with existing rheumatic diseases, such as rheumatoid arthritis or lupus, have a much higher risk of developing 'secondary' fibromyalgia. Furthermore, those who have experienced significant childhood adversity or chronic psychological stress are statistically more likely to develop central pain disorders later in life.
There is no guaranteed way to prevent fibromyalgia because of its strong genetic component. However, evidence-based strategies to reduce risk include maintaining a consistent sleep schedule, managing stress through cognitive behavioral techniques, and engaging in regular low-impact aerobic exercise. Early intervention for acute pain and psychological trauma may also prevent the transition from acute pain to the chronic central sensitization seen in fibromyalgia.
Diagnosis is primarily clinical, meaning it is based on your history and physical examination. There is currently no definitive 'gold standard' blood test or imaging study to confirm fibromyalgia. The diagnostic journey often involves ruling out other conditions that cause similar symptoms, such as hypothyroidism, multiple sclerosis, or inflammatory arthritis.
During the exam, a healthcare provider will check for pain in specific areas of the body. While the '18 tender points' test was once the standard, modern diagnosis focuses on the areas of pain reported over the previous week and the severity of associated symptoms like fatigue and cognitive issues.

The primary goals of fibromyalgia treatment are to manage pain, improve sleep quality, and enhance overall physical and emotional function. Because symptoms vary, treatment must be highly individualized. Successful treatment often results in a 'reduction' of symptoms rather than a total 'cure.'
Current guidelines from the European Alliance of Associations for Rheumatology (EULAR, 2024) and the ACR emphasize a multidisciplinary approach. The first-line recommendation is non-pharmacological therapy, specifically patient education and graded exercise programs. Medication is typically introduced when lifestyle changes alone are insufficient.

If first-line medications are ineffective, doctors may try 'off-label' options or combinations of the classes mentioned above. In some cases, low-dose naltrexone or certain NMDA receptor antagonists are explored in clinical settings.
Fibromyalgia management is typically long-term. Patients should have regular follow-ups (every 3–6 months) to assess the efficacy of medications and adjust exercise protocols. Monitoring for side effects and mental health (depression/anxiety) is critical.

While there is no specific 'fibromyalgia diet,' research suggests that an anti-inflammatory eating pattern may help. A study in the Nutrients journal (2023) found that patients following a Mediterranean-style diet reported lower pain scores. Reducing intake of excitotoxins (like MSG and aspartame) and highly processed sugars may also reduce 'fibro fog' and systemic inflammation.
Exercise is the most effective non-drug treatment for fibromyalgia. The key is 'start low and go slow.' Low-impact aerobic activities such as walking, swimming, or tai chi are recommended for at least 20–30 minutes, three times a week. Avoid high-impact activities that can trigger a pain flare.
Strict sleep hygiene is essential. This includes maintaining a consistent sleep-wake cycle, keeping the bedroom cool and dark, and avoiding screens (blue light) at least one hour before bed. Since many patients have 'alpha-delta sleep' (where deep sleep is interrupted by wakeful brain waves), minimizing caffeine after noon is vital.
Chronic stress exacerbates central sensitization. Evidence-based techniques include mindfulness-based stress reduction (MBSR), progressive muscle relaxation, and deep breathing exercises. These practices help down-regulate the sympathetic nervous system (the 'fight or flight' response).
Caregivers should educate themselves on the fluctuating nature of the disease. Validation is key—acknowledging that the pain is real even if it cannot be seen. Encouraging gentle activity while respecting the patient's need for rest during flares helps maintain a supportive environment.
Fibromyalgia is a chronic, life-long condition, but it is not progressive or life-threatening. It does not cause damage to the joints, muscles, or internal organs. According to a long-term study published in Arthritis Care & Research, approximately 25% of patients see significant improvement in their symptoms over time with a multidisciplinary management plan. While most patients will continue to experience some level of symptoms, many learn to manage them effectively so they do not dominate their lives.

While no specific diet is proven to cure fibromyalgia, many patients report significant symptom improvement through nutritional changes. An anti-inflammatory diet, such as the Mediterranean diet, which is rich in fruits, vegetables, and healthy fats, is often recommended by specialists. Some individuals find relief by eliminating potential triggers like artificial sweeteners, MSG, and excessive caffeine. Maintaining a healthy weight is also crucial, as excess weight puts additional stress on painful joints and muscles.
Fibromyalgia is difficult to diagnose because its primary symptoms—pain and fatigue—are subjective and common to many other medical conditions. There is no definitive imaging or blood test that can 'see' fibromyalgia, forcing doctors to rely on patient history and the exclusion of other diseases. Additionally, symptoms often fluctuate in intensity, which can lead to inconsistent clinical presentations during office visits. The lack of a simple diagnostic marker often results in a multi-year journey for patients seeking a formal diagnosis.
Exercise is not only safe but is considered the most effective non-drug treatment for managing fibromyalgia symptoms. While it may seem counterintuitive to move when in pain, physical activity helps maintain muscle strength and reduces the sensitivity of the nervous system. The key is to engage in low-impact activities like walking or swimming and to increase intensity very gradually. Over-exertion can trigger a flare, so it is important to listen to your body and find a sustainable balance.
Flares can be triggered by a variety of internal and external factors, including emotional stress, physical injury, or illness. Environmental changes, such as cold or damp weather and fluctuations in barometric pressure, are also frequently cited by patients. Poor sleep quality and overexertion during a 'good day' can lead to a 'crash' or flare-up shortly after. Identifying these personal triggers through a daily journal can help patients take preventive measures to minimize the frequency of these episodes.
Fibromyalgia is not considered a progressive disease, meaning it does not naturally worsen or cause physical damage over time. However, the challenges of aging, such as declining muscle mass and the onset of osteoarthritis, can make managing fibromyalgia symptoms more difficult. Many older adults find that their symptoms stabilize once they find an effective management routine. Early and consistent treatment is the best way to ensure a high quality of life as one ages with the condition.
Yes, children and adolescents can be diagnosed with Juvenile Primary Fibromyalgia Syndrome (JPFS). It most commonly appears during the teenage years and is more prevalent in girls than boys. Symptoms in children are similar to those in adults but often include a higher incidence of headaches and significant sleep disturbances that can affect school performance. Early diagnosis and a focus on physical activity and psychological support are vital for helping children manage the condition effectively.
Many people with fibromyalgia continue to work, though some may require workplace accommodations or a shift to more flexible schedules. The 'invisible' nature of the fatigue and cognitive fog can make traditional 9-to-5 roles challenging during flares. Under the Americans with Disabilities Act (ADA), employees in the U.S. may be entitled to reasonable accommodations such as ergonomic chairs or modified break schedules. For some, the severity of the condition may eventually necessitate a transition to part-time work or disability benefits.
Fibromyalgia does not typically affect fertility or the health of the developing baby, but it can make the experience of pregnancy more physically demanding. Pregnant women with fibromyalgia may experience increased back pain, fatigue, and joint pressure as the pregnancy progresses. Because many fibromyalgia medications are not safe during pregnancy, patients must work closely with their rheumatologist and obstetrician to manage pain safely. Most women find that their symptoms return to pre-pregnancy levels after delivery, though postpartum fatigue can be significant.
